The US Department of Interior recently issued an order that significantly looks to expand oil and gas leases in the Gulf of Mexico, and off the coast of Alaska and California. This expansion covers 1.27 billion acres of ocean. Additionally, the Interior Department plans to sell more leases in 80 million acres in the Gulf of Mexico on December 10, 2025. In this episode I take a look at a blue paper published by the Ocean Panel on the impacts to the worldwide workforce if we take action and create a sustainable ocean economy versus not doing anything to help preserve the ocean. Currently, the worldwide workforce tied to the ocean economy is about 133 million. If we pursue sustainable practices that number could rise by 51 million more workers by 2050. The Dive Pirates Foundation is an organization dedicated to enabling individuals with physical disabilities enjoy the underwater world through scuba diving. Their motto is "We no longer see disabilities, we see possibilities". Each year, Dive Pirates runs a dive trip for adaptive divers, their buddies and volunteers. Oceana recently released a report - Plastic Foam Needs 'To Go' Plastic foam is one type of polystyrene that is incredibly harmful to the environment and human health. Most US registered voters agree and 78% support policies that reduce single-use plastic foam. In November 2024, the EPA released the National Strategy to Prevent Plastic Pollution. This strategy was developed in accordance with the Save Our Seas Act 2.0 of 2020 signed by President Trump on December 18, 2020.
